Class: Mention::AlertCreator

Inherits:
Object
  • Object
show all
Defined in:
lib/mention/alert_creator.rb

Instance Method Summary collapse

Constructor Details

#initialize(account_resource, alert) ⇒ AlertCreator

Returns a new instance of AlertCreator.



3
4
5
# File 'lib/mention/alert_creator.rb', line 3

def initialize(, alert)
  @account_resource, @alert = , alert
end

Instance Method Details

#created_alertObject



7
8
9
# File 'lib/mention/alert_creator.rb', line 7

def created_alert
  @created_alert ||= Alert.new(response['alert'])
end

#valid?Boolean

Returns:

  • (Boolean)


11
12
13
14
# File 'lib/mention/alert_creator.rb', line 11

def valid?
  validate_response!
  true
end